Episode 144: Confidence Through Change, 10 Strategies to Help Your Children Adapt

This podcast episode is focused on helping children navigate changes effectively by providing strategies for parents.
In the segment, DJ discusses the importance of structure, stability, and resilience in managing both big changes like divorce or moving, as well as smaller ones like routine adjustments. Listen in as she advises parents to acknowledge their own emotions and involve children in decision-making processes to help them feel heard and secure. Stay tuned! The episode also highlights the significance of maintaining routines, offering choices, and fostering open communication to support children through various life changes, ultimately emphasizing the role of parents as anchors and sources of comfort for their children.
TIMESTAMPS
• [1:28] DJ suggests that changes, even small ones, can be challenging for children and adults alike, and it's important to check in with your own emotions and assess how you are feeling about the change.
• [7:18] DJ also suggests involving children in planning and preparation for moves or changes to help them manage their emotions and feel more in control (17:18).
• [15:01] DJ discusses how to talk to children about absent loved ones, emphasizing honesty and openness while avoiding embellishment.
• [31:13] DJ emphasizes the importance of consistency and familiarity for children during times of change, serving as a source of comfort and stability.
